In 1804, Susanna ASH entered the world in York St., Bristol, Gloucestershire, England., born to Joseph Ash Rev And Susanna Day. In 1841, Susanna ASH resided in Upton Upon Severn, Worcestershire, England. Susanna ASH married John Freer, and had children including Elizabeth Ash Freer, Frederick Ash Freer, Henry Ash Freer, John Ash Freer, Joseph Ash Freer, Susannah Ash Freer, William Ash Freer. Susanna ASH passed away in 1843 in Upton On Severn, Worcestershire, England..
